Does Revolut charge for foreign ATM withdrawal?
You can use your Revolut card to withdraw money in the local currency at a foreign ATM. It doesn't charge you a fee to do this, but bear in mind that many ATM operators do charge their own fees for using the ATM. Just like with spending, there are limits to how much money you can withdraw using your ATM card.Free withdrawals up to 5 ATM Withdrawals or 800 RON per rolling month (whichever comes first), then a fee applies. That fee is 2% of the withdrawal, subject to a minimum fee of 5 RON per withdrawal.This fee is defined by the merchant. There might also be fees if you exceed your foreign exchange allowance. You can withdraw cash using your Revolut card worldwide, although some countries aren't supported — read this list of unsupported countries to find out more.

You're able to withdraw money from any ATM that supports Visa or Mastercard in your home country or overseas. We urge you to look out for fees that some ATM operators might apply — they usually tell you how much they'll charge you to withdraw money on-screen.

What is the best way to use Revolut abroad

Simply use your travel money card while you're abroad, and we'll auto-convert your balance to the currency you're spending in at competitive rates. Plus, you can use multi-currency accounts to keep different currencies for your next destination.

  1. Choose “Decline Conversion” while withdrawing cash abroad.
  2. Choose to be charged in the local currency.
  3. Use ATM Fee Saver to find fee-free ATMs or low fee ATMs when withdrawing cash abroad.
  4. Try 2-3 ATMs before withdrawing cash abroad.
  5. Use your own bank's foreign ATM if terms offer free withdrawals.

What countries do not accept Revolut : Countries we do not support payments in include but are not limited to: Belarus, Crimea, Cuba, Iran, North Korea, Libya, Myanmar, Russia, Syrian Arab Republic, Venezuela, and Zimbabwe. Depending on your region, this list may not be exhaustive, and it's subject to change.
